Embodiment 1

[0018] Repair of high pressure water descaling header in X steel plant.

[0019] The base material of the high pressure water descaling header is 34CrNiMo 6 .

[0020] The chemical composition of the cladding material is Ni: 35%, Cu: 20%, Fe: 10%, La: 0.2%, Yb: 0.2%, Y: 0.2%, Sc: 0.2%, Pr: 0.2%, Cr: Yu quantity.

[0021] Since there is an included angle of 15° between the repair surface of the descaling header and the horizontal, it is adjusted through the hydraulic system to make the repair surface consistent with the horizontal plane, and a level is used for correction.

[0022] The laser repair process of the high-pressure water descaling header, the steps are as follows: Step 1. Abstract

The invention belongs to the field of repair of high-pressure water descaling equipment and relates to a method adopting the laser cladding technology to repair a high-pressure water descaling header,in particular to a laser repair method for a high-pressure water descaling header. Anti-corrosion alloy powder for laser cladding mainly comprises the following chemical ingredients: 35-40% of Ni, 15-20% of Cu and 10-12% of Fe. Besides the above ingredients, at least three of the following rare earth elements are added by percent: 0.1-1% of La, 0.1-0.5% of Yb, 0.1-0.5% of Y, 0.1-0.5% of Sc, 0.1-0.5% of Pr and the balance of Cr. The problem that only maintenance but not change for new is allowed is effectively solved, and the technical cost in high-pressure water descaling is greatly lowered.

technical field [0001] The invention belongs to the field of repairing high-pressure water descaling equipment, and in particular relates to a method for repairing a high-pressure water descaling header by using laser cladding technology, specifically a laser repair method for a high-pressure water descaling header. Background technique [0002] It is used for the internal descaling header of the high-pressure water descaling box for hot-rolled strips. The bearing descaling pressure is generally about 400bar, and the descaling water quality is weakly alkaline. At 1200°C, the junction surface of the descaling header nozzle is prone to thermal deformation; the nozzle surface of the header and the inlet side are continuously washed and worn by the high-pressure descaling water rebounded from the slab (the rebounded high-pressure descaling water contains a large amount of high-speed splash At the same time, a large amount of water vapor headers are corroded during production.
